What are the interfaces of UMTS?

There are four interfaces connecting the UTRAN internally or externally to other functional entities: Iu, Uu, Iub and Iur . The Iu interface is an external interface that connects the RNC to the Core Network (CN). The Uu is also external, connecting Node B with the User Equipment (UE).

What is 3G UMTS?

UMTS (Universal Mobile Telecommunications Service) is a third-generation (3G) broadband, packet-based transmission of text, digitized voice, video, and multimedia at data rates up to 2 megabits per second (Mbps) .

Is 3G network good?

If you use your phone mostly to talk and text and only occasionally stream video or music while on the mobile network, 3G will probably work well for you . Most other commonly used mobile apps – email, social media, weather, web browser, etc – work fine on a 3G network.
